In the early 20th century, the quest for flight captivated inventors and scientists alike, marking a pivotal moment in aeronautics. "Artificial and Natural Flight" by Hiram S. Maxim explores the intricate mechanics that govern both human-made and avian flight, revealing groundbreaking principles that shaped modern aviation. Maxim meticulously analyzes the forces of lift and drag, offering insights into the design of successful flying machines.
